What Causes Microsoft Edge Error Code RESULT_CODE_KILLED_BAD_MESSAGE?
This error means Edge's renderer process was terminated due to a "bad message." Common culprits include:
- π Corrupted cache or browsing data
- π Faulty or outdated extensions
- βοΈ Profile corruption
- π± Outdated Edge version or Windows conflicts
- π« Malware or conflicting software
Recognizing the cause helps you target the fix. Now, let's tackle it head-on with proven solutions.
Step-by-Step Fixes: How to Fix Microsoft Edge Error Code RESULT_CODE_KILLED_BAD_MESSAGE
Start with the quickest wins and escalate if needed. Most users resolve it in under 10 minutes! β
1οΈβ£ Quick Restart and Task Manager Check
π Press Ctrl + Shift + Esc to open Task Manager. End all Microsoft Edge processes (msedge.exe). Relaunch Edge. This clears temporary hangs.
If it persists, move to cache clearing.
2οΈβ£ Clear Cache and Browsing Data
Corrupted cache is the #1 villain. Here's how:
- Open Edge β Settings (three dots) β Privacy, search, and services.
- Under Clear browsing data, choose All time and select Cached images/files + Cookies.
- Click Clear now.
Restart Edge. Boomβfixed for many! 
3οΈβ£ Disable Extensions
Extensions often send "bad messages." Test in Incognito (Ctrl + Shift + N)βif no error, it's an extension.
- edge://extensions/
- Toggle off all β Restart Edge β Re-enable one by one.
Pro tip: Remove suspects like ad blockers first.
4οΈβ£ Reset Edge Settings
For deeper issues:
- edge://settings/reset
- Restore settings to their default values β Reset.
This won't delete bookmarks but refreshes everything. 
5οΈβ£ Update or Reinstall Edge
Ensure you're on the latest version:
- edge://settings/help β Check for updates.
Still stuck? Uninstall via Settings > Apps > Microsoft Edge > Uninstall, then download fresh from Microsoft Edge official site.

Prevention Tips to Avoid Future Microsoft Edge Error Code RESULT_CODE_KILLED_BAD_MESSAGE
- π Regularly update Edge and Windows.
- π§Ή Clear cache weekly.
- β Vet extensionsβstick to trusted ones.
- π‘οΈ Run antivirus scans.
- π Backup profiles periodically.
